Loss Minimization by Optimal DG Placement on Radial Distribution Network
Journal Title: International Journal for Research in Applied Science and Engineering Technology (IJRASET) - Year 2016, Vol 4, Issue 12
Abstract
With the increase in load demand and efforts to reduce distribution system losses, to increase the efficiency of the distribution system maintaining proper voltage profile and for the future expansion of the distribution network optimal distribution system planning is therefore very important and this important task must be solved in an optimal way. In this paper, IEEE-33 bus system is considered for optimally allocating the distributed generation source at some of the buses. The following effort explains that by placing distributed generation at most sensitive buses the real power losses in the system can be reduced drastically and voltage profile can also be improved. The sites for distributed generation are selected on the basis of sensitivity and the amount of real power source at that bus is decided by applying Local Search Method.
